Subject: DR drill — RestockPilot, Thursday 06:00

On-call: Thursday we simulate total loss of the RestockPilot planner at the Varnholt depot. Primary DB gets nuked at 06:00 sharp. Your job: restore from the cold snapshot, bring the route optimizer up, confirm machine fill forecasts regenerate within 20 minutes. Do not page the vendor team; this is ours. Checklist is in the drill folder. Restore requires unlocking the snapshot archive, and the passphrase for that is below.

vault phrase of hahop-badug = novvan-ulaion-zorius-noviel-gorwyn-casix-tamys

- [ ] Step 7: Archive cold storage buckets (Glacierline tier). Confirm both ceremony witnesses are present, verify bucket manifests match the Oxbow ledger, then seal the archive key shares. Plugin authors may observe but not handle shares. Once sealed, the archive index itself is encrypted and can only be reopened with the passphrase below.

vault phrase of badup-hahig = tamael-aldael-kelmir-istael-fenok-istwyn-tamius-jorath-oliion

// ENCODING_SNIFF_LIMIT controls how many bytes Quillbarn reads when
// guessing the encoding of uploaded text files. We try BOM detection
// first, then a UTF-8 validity pass, then fall back to the tenant's
// declared legacy charset. Raising this improves accuracy on CJK
// content but slows the upload path, so change it only with a
// benchmark attached. The current value was validated under the
// build referenced immediately below.

pipeline stamp: htk9_ce63042d9